The Works Workshop Series- DIY Bottle Lamp

Ever wanted to learn how to create your own custom bottle lamp? Sit down and chat with the pro's for one lazy Sunday afternoon and learn how to assemble your own quirky light piece (RRP $110). You'll walk away with a new skillset and an excellent gift or fine addition to the home! Materials are supplied as well as some nibbles to keep you going throughout the afternoon. No experience necessary!

​Your lovely tutor for the afternoon will be Juan from the amazing industrial design label Mas Des Trefles and Dan from Mountain Boat Design. Juan is a stall holder in The Works Glebe, a qualified electrician, steampunk enthusiast and bespoke lighting afficianado. Dan is an employee of The Works Glebe and also a skilled graphic designer with a passion for upcycling and repurposing vintage finds.

The workshop will begin with a half hour introduction and overview on creating your own bespoke electrical items safely and skillfully.

You will then be split into two groups, one working with Juan to prepare the bottle and install the electrical components and the other working with Dan to recover the lampshade with a fabric of your choice.

Once participants have completed both components there'll be time for a photoshoot, final Q&A and a refreshing ale.

Expect a fun afternoon learning new skills, meeting new people and walking away with your own custom made lamp!
